• Virtualization
Physical & Virtual Scalability
Hosts
• Support for up to 320 logical processors& 4TB physical memory per host
• Support for up to 1,024 virtual machines per host
Clusters
• Support for up to 64 physical nodes & 8,000 virtual machines per cluster
Virtual Machines
• Support for up to 64 virtual processors and 1TB memory per VM

Generation 2 Virtual Machines
Ease of Management & Operations
• PXE boot from Optimized vNIC
• Hot-Add CD/DVD Drive
Dynamic Storage
• VMs have UEFI firmware with supportfor GPT partitioned OS boot disks >2TB
• Faster Boot from Virtual SCSI with OnlineResize & increased performance
Security
• Removal of emulated devices reduces attack surface
• VM UEFI firmware supports Secure Boot

Online VHDX Resize
Expand Virtual SCSI Disks
1. Grow VHD & VHDX files whilst attachedto a running virtual machine
2. Then expand volume within the guest
Shrink Virtual SCSI Disks
3. Reduce volume size inside the guest
4. Shrink the size of the VHDor VHDX file whilst the VM is running
Online VHDX Resize provides VM storage flexibility

Storage Quality of Service
• Allows an administrator to specify a maximum IOPS cap
• Takes into account incoming & outgoing IOPS
• Configurable on a VHDX by VHDXbasis for granular control whilst VM is running
• Prevents VMs from consuming allof the available I/O bandwidth tothe underlying physical resource
• Supports Dynamic, Fixed& Differencing
Control allocation of Storage IOPS between VM Disks

Linux Support on Hyper-V
Significant Improvements in Interoperability
• Multiple supported Linux distributionsand versions on Hyper-V.
• Includes Red Hat, SUSE, OpenSUSE, CentOS, and Ubuntu
Comprehensive Feature Support
• 64 vCPU SMP
• Virtual SCSI, Hot-Add & Online Resize
• Full Dynamic Memory Support
• Live Backup
• Deeper Integration Services Support
Comprehensive feature support for virtualized Linux

Shared-Nothing Live Migration
• Increase flexibility of virtual machine placement & increased administrator efficiency
• Simultaneously live migrate VM & virtual disks between hosts
• Nothing shared but an ethernet cable
• No clustering or shared storage requirements
• Reduce downtime for migrations across cluster boundaries
Complete Flexibility for Virtual Machine Migrations

High-performance live migration
Accelerate live migration performance with compression or RDMA-capable network adapters
For <10GBit network connectivity, live migration compression delivers superior performance – 2x acceleration for most workloads
For >10GBit networks, Remote direct memory access (RDMA) offload delivers the highest performance with low CPU utilization and transfer speeds of up to 56Gb/s
Windows Server 2012 R2 supports RoCE, iWARP and Infiniband RDMA solutions

Virtual Machine Live Cloning
Export a clone of a running VM
• Point-time image of running VMexported to an alternate location
• Useful for troubleshooting VMwithout downtime for primary VM
Export from an existing checkpoint
• Export a full cloned virtual machinefrom a point-in-time, existing checkpoint of a virtual machine
• Checkpoints automatically merged into single virtual disk
Duplication of a Virtual Machine whilst Running
VM1 VM2
1 User Initiates an export of a running VM
2Hyper-V performs a live, point-in-time export of the VM, which remains running, creating the new files in the target location
3 Admin imports new, powered-off VM on the target host, finalizes configuration and starts VM
4 With Virtual Machine Manager, Admin can select host as part of the clone wizard
Live Migration Upgrades
• Customers can upgrade from Windows Server 2012 Hyper-V to Windows Server 2012 R2 Preview Hyper-V with no VM downtime
• Supports Shared Nothing Live Migration for migration when changing storage locations
• If using SMB share, migration transfers only the VM running state for faster completion
• Automated with PowerShell
• One-way Migration Only
Simplified upgrade process from 2012 to 2012 R2

Guest Clustering with Shared VHDX
• VHDX files can be presented to multiple VMs simultaneously, as shared storage
• VM sees shared virtual SAS disk
• Unrestricted number of VMs canconnect to a shared VHDX file
• Utilizes SCSI-persistent reservations
• VHDX can reside on a Cluster Shared Volume on block storage, or onFile-based storage
• Supports both Dynamic and Fixed VHDX
Guest Clustering No Longer Bound to Storage Topology

Hyper-V Replica | Extended Replication
• Once a VM has been successfully replicated to the replica site, replicacan be replicated to a 3rd location
• Chained Replication
• Extended Replica contents match the original replication contents
• Extended Replica replication frequencies can differ from original replica
• Useful for scenarios such as SMB -> Service Provider -> Service Provider DR Site
Replicate to 3rd Location for Extra Level of Resiliency

Hybrid storage pools & tiered storage
• SSDs and HDDs used as different tiers in the same storage pool.
• Windows automatically tracks data temperature and moves them at sub-file level.
• Write-back cache improves performance for real-world workloads.
• Only hot regions of a file (VHD, database, etc.) need to move to SSDs, the cold regions can reside on HDDs.
• Ability to pin files to different tiers Hybrid storage pool

NIC teaming• Provides network fault tolerance and
continuous availability when network adapters fail by teaming multiple network interfaces
• New in R2: enhanced LBFO performance
• Vendor agnostic and shipped inbox
• Provides local or remote management through Windows PowerShell or UI
• Enables teams of up to 32 network adapters
• Aggregates bandwidth from multiple network adapters
• Includes multiple nodes: switch dependent and independent

Classic “Full Server”• Full Metro-style GUI shell.
• Install Desktop Experience to run Metro-style apps.
Full Server without Server Graphical Shell• No Explorer, Internet Explorer or associated files.
• MMC, Server Manager, and a subset of Control Panel applets are still installed.
• Provides many of the benefits of Server Core for those applications or users that haven’t yet made the transition.
Server Core• Can move between Server Core and Full Server by simply
installing or uninstalling components.
